The Haemopoietic Stem Cell Program is a collaboration between Cancer and Blood Disorders and Pathology Queensland within Cancer Access and Support Services of the Gold Coast Health Service District. The service is responsible for the collection, processing and administration of cellular therapy products within the Gold Coast University Hospital.
